Synopsis
In the gripping 2016 Argentinian thriller film 'At the End of the Tunnel' directed by Rodrigo Grande, Leonardo Sbaraglia portrays Joaquín, a paraplegic man who begins eavesdropping on a dangerous criminal conspiracy unfolding in his own home. Determined to outwit the criminals, Joaquín embarks on a high-stakes game of cat and mouse, utilizing his wit and resourcefulness to outmaneuver the threats lurking at the end of his tunnel. As tensions rise and secrets unravel, Joaquín finds himself entangled in a web of deception and danger that will test his limits and resolve in ways he never imagined.

Reviews
The 2016 film 'At the End of the Tunnel' has garnered positive reviews from critics and audiences alike. Rotten Tomatoes gives it an impressive rating of 83%, praising its suspenseful storyline and strong performances, particularly Leonardo Sbaraglia's portrayal as Joaquín. IMDb rates the film with a solid 7.0/10, indicating a favorable reception among viewers. Critics have lauded the film for its tense atmosphere, clever plot twists, and engaging character development. The seamless blend of thriller and drama elements keeps viewers on the edge of their seats throughout the narrative, making 'At the End of the Tunnel' a standout in the suspense genre.
